Garage Door Lock Replacement: A Comprehensive Guide
Garage door locks play an essential function in securing your home and its belongings. Nevertheless, there might come a time when you need to replace these locks due to wear and tear, lost keys, or security upgrades. This article will guide you through the whole process of replacing a garage door lock, including the kinds of locks offered, tools required, a detailed guide, and frequently asked concerns.

Why Replace Your Garage Door Lock?
Before diving into the how-to portion of this guide, it makes sense to comprehend the "why" behind garage door lock replacement. Here are a couple of reasons why house owners may think about changing their locks:
- Security Concerns: If you've lost keys or experienced a burglary, updating your garage door lock can enhance your home's security.
- Use and Tear: Over time, locks can end up being rusty or jammed, leading to functionality issues.
- Upgrading: More advanced locking mechanisms can provide better security functions such as keypad entry or smart locks.
- New Home: If you've just recently moved into a new home, changing the garage door lock is a smart way to ensure that you have the only secrets.

Actions for Replacing Your Garage Door Lock
Follow these simple actions to change your garage door lock:
Step 1: Choose the Right Lock
Select the type of lock that satisfies your security needs and works with your garage door. Consider consulting a professional for recommendations.
Action 2: Gather Tools and Materials
Collect all required tools and new lock parts. Check out the installation handbook that includes your new lock.
Step 3: Remove the Old Lock
- Locate the screws: Find the screws holding the lock in place.
- Unscrew the lock: Use a screwdriver to remove the screws. Thoroughly remove the old lock.
- Check for wear: If the lock has caused damage to the door frame, you may likewise require to resolve this.
Step 4: Install the New Lock
- Align the New Lock: Position the new lock where the old one was, ensuring it fits comfortably.
- Connect the knob lock replacement: Secure the lock in location with screws. Ensure it's straight utilizing the level.
- Check the Lock: Before ending up, check the lock several times to guarantee it works properly.
Step 5: Lubricate and Maintain
When installed, apply lubricant to the lock mechanism to guarantee smooth operation. Routine maintenance can extend the life of the lock.
Maintenance Tips for Your Garage Door Lock
To keep your garage door lock operating at its best, consider the following suggestions:
- Regular Lubrication: Apply lubricant every few months.
- Examine for Damage: Regularly look for signs of wear, rust, or any breakdown.
- Keep it Clean: Dirt and debris can cause locks to jam. Clean the location around the lock.
- Upgrade When Necessary: Stay mindful of developments in lock innovation and consider upgrading for added security.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q1: How frequently should I change my garage door lock?
A: It's usually suggested to examine your locks annually and change them every 5-7 years or sooner if issues arise.
Q2: Can I change the lock myself, or should I call an expert?
A: While numerous property owners can handle door locks lock replacements, anyone not sure about the process should seek advice from an expert to avoid damaging their garage pocket door lock replacement.
Q3: What if my garage door lock is jammed?
A: Try lubricating the lock with a graphite or silicone spray. If it stays stuck, a lock specialist may need to examine the problem.
